Subject: [PATCH for-4.7] mkelf32: fix compilation on 32 bit build host
Date: Fri, 29 Apr 2016 18:25:31 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1461950731-14212-1-git-send-email-wei.liu2@citrix.com> (raw)

When cross-compiling xen on a 32 bit build host:

boot/mkelf32.c: In function 'main':
boot/mkelf32.c:360:21: error: format '%ld' expects argument of type 'long int', but argument 3 has type 'Elf64_Off' [-Werror=format]
cc1: all warnings being treated as errors

Fix that by using PRId64 in format string.

diff --git a/xen/arch/x86/boot/mkelf32.c b/xen/arch/x86/boot/mkelf32.c
index 8c51990..6cfa312 100644
--- a/xen/arch/x86/boot/mkelf32.c
+++ b/xen/arch/x86/boot/mkelf32.c
@@ -356,7 +356,7 @@ int main(int argc, char **argv)
         if ( in64_phdr.p_offset > dat_siz || offset > in64_phdr.p_offset )
         {
             fprintf(stderr, "Expected .note section within .text section!\n" \
-                    "Offset %ld not within %d!\n",
+                    "Offset %"PRId64" not within %d!\n",
                     in64_phdr.p_offset, dat_siz);
             return 1;
         }
